Hey guys, I just got a Hoyt MT Sport w/ ZR200 limbs the other day but I'm pretty green to hunting. I was wondering what tips you guys would have on what else to purchase or anything helpful for a new hunter thanks.
#2
First of all learn to shoot your bow correctly. Do all the ground work you can first, learn to shoot solid groups, even the best bow hunters misjudge distance.
Then read all you can about bow hunting, there a lot of stuff on the Internet. If you can get with a group of guys you know that have been in the sport a while and glean all you can from them.. There is a lot of good information on this forum too. Welcome to one of the most addicting and rewarding sports in the world.

I would learn as much as you can about proper shooting form. Particularly grip and follow through. It has taken me 5 years to learn just how important my grip is to consistent, accurate shooting. Also, dont be afraid to ask questions at your local bow shop or on forums like this. The guys and gals here offer a wealth of experience.
